A History Of Our Location
TAYLOR HILL
• Built in 1815 by George Ives. William Cullen Bryant and his bride lived here with their daughter, Frances, who was born here. Ralph Taylor, Ives’ brother-in-law, purchased the property in 1826 and named it Taylor Hill. After his death in 1886, his son Charles J. Taylor owned it, writing his town history in the small, detached building just south of the main building.
• 1921 Henry A. Stevens moved the funeral home business to its current location.
• September 1964 - Milton L. Stevens moved a home from Elm Street in Great Barrington to its current location on South Street, just above Finnerty & Stevens Funeral Home.
• 1999 addition was added that double the size of the funeral home.
